Directors


Picture

​Jamie Saltman
was literally born into Encore/Coda in 1957, just a few years after his parents, Ruth and Phil Saltman, created the program in 1950. He has college degrees in music education and conducting and over 40 years' experience as a music teacher and camp director. In addition to camp work during the school year, he teaches piano at home in South Brookline, MA and plays professionally in the greater Boston area.


Ellen Donohue-Saltman has been at Encore/Coda since she & Jamie got engaged in 1980. She has college degrees in political economy and French horn performance and over 38 years' experience as a music teacher and camp director. In addition to camp work during the school year, she teaches French horn in several Boston-area school systems as well as at home and plays professionally in the greater Boston area.


Picture

Cara Bergantino began her time at camp in 2003 as an intermediate camper. Every year since then, she has returned to Encore/Coda as a senior camper, CIT, junior counselor, senior counselor, head counselor, and now assistant director.  She has a college degree in music education with an emphasis on viola performance. Outside of camp, Cara works as a music teacher in Massachusetts in the Newton Public Schools, and as a private instructor. Cara also continues her work for Camp E/C in the off-season doing projects such as social media posting, video editing, recruiting, camp fairs, hiring, and administrative work.
​
Picture

Andrew Neyer has been on head staff at camp since his first summer in 2009.  Before that, he was the CIT director at Camp Chateaugay (Merrill, NY), and assistant director at Omni Camp (Poland, ME).  He has undergraduate college degrees in music and mathematics/statistics and a graduate degree in math education.  Outside of camp, Andrew is a full-timemath teacher at The Webb Schools in Claremont, CA.  He has previously held teaching posts at Cushing Academy in Ashburnham, MA, and the Leysin American School in Switzerland.
